Most jellyfish stings improve within hours, but some stings can lead to skin irritation or rashes. How long do jellyfish rashes last? But some jellyfish stings can lead to rashes that can last for weeks. The welts may last for 1 to 2 weeks, and itchy skin rashes may appear 1 to 4 weeks after the sting.
